Cp Growth Charts - It's caused by damage that occurs to the developing brain, most often before birth. Cp is the most common motor disability. Cerebral palsy (cp) is a group of neurologic disorders that cause problems with movement, balance, and posture. In many cases, cerebral palsy also affects vision, hearing, and sensation.
